Is Conor McGregor's Suspension Fair? Ex-UFC Fighter Matt Brown Weighs In (2025)

The world of UFC is abuzz with controversy as a former fighter speaks out against the promotion's recent decision.

'It's just not right!' That's the sentiment expressed by ex-UFC star Matt Brown regarding Conor McGregor's 18-month suspension. The suspension, which is retroactive, has sparked debates about fairness and potential conflicts of interest within the organization.

McGregor, the former champion, was set to make a highly anticipated return to the Octagon next summer at the prestigious UFC White House card. However, his plans have been abruptly halted due to a violation of the CSAD anti-doping policy. The Irish fighter failed to report his whereabouts for random drug testing on three separate occasions, leading to the suspension.

But here's where it gets controversial: Brown, a former welterweight contender, questions the integrity of the suspension. He argues that the UFC's control over doping regulations, especially after their deal with USADA ended, could lead to potential favoritism. Brown suggests that the promotion might turn a blind eye to certain fighters' doping violations, which could give them an unfair advantage.

In a bold statement, Brown said, "Who's to say they're not letting certain people dope and not even saying anything?" He further implied that the UFC might protect McGregor's involvement in the White House event, regardless of any potential doping violations, due to the high-profile nature of the card.
